station 4:

  • directions: indicate whether each statement occurs in mitosis, meiosis, or both stages. write the number of the box below in the correct space on your sheet.
  1. creates 2 identical cells
  2. goes through a stage called metaphase
  3. creates 4 unique cells
  4. occurs in plants and animals
  5. creates a human cell with 23 chromosomes
  6. creates a human cell with 46 chromosomes
  7. diploid cells are created
  8. haploid cells are created
  9. contributes to genetic diversity in organisms

Explanation:

Brief Explanations
  1. Mitosis produces 2 genetically identical daughter cells from one parent cell.
  2. Both mitosis and meiosis have a metaphase stage, where chromosomes align at the cell's equator.
  3. Meiosis produces 4 genetically unique haploid cells through two rounds of division.
  4. Both mitosis (for growth/repair) and meiosis (for gamete production) occur in plants and animals.
  5. Human meiosis creates gametes (sperm/egg) with 23 chromosomes, the haploid number.
  6. Human mitosis creates somatic cells with 46 chromosomes, the diploid number matching the parent cell.
  7. Mitosis generates diploid cells that have the full set of chromosomes matching the parent.
  8. Meiosis generates haploid cells that have half the chromosome number of the parent.
  9. Meiosis creates genetically unique cells via crossing over and independent assortment, driving genetic diversity.

Answer:

  • Mitosis: 1, 6, 7
  • Meiosis: 3, 5, 8, 9
  • Both: 2, 4
